How to Determine the Success of Your Marketing Funnel
Determining the success of a marketing funnel is essential for understanding its efficiency and recognizing areas for enhancement. This can be achieved through making use of various crucial performance indicators (KPIs), consisting of conversion rates, client lifetime value, and return on investment.
By examining these metrics, businesses can examine the efficiency of each phase of the funnel in appealing and converting leads. This assessment assists in data-driven decision-making, ultimately improving marketing strategies and enhancing future projects.
Conversion Rates
Conversion rates serve as an important metric for assessing the efficiency of a marketing funnel, as they reflect the percentage of leads that successfully advance from one phase to the next, eventually resulting in a purchase. High conversion rates indicate that marketing methods effectively engage prospects and fulfill their needs, whereas low rates might reveal locations in the funnel that need improvement.
To properly calculate conversion rates at each stage, it is essential to compare the overall variety of visitors or leads at the start of the funnel with those who effectively progress through the subsequent stages.
Define each stage: awareness, factor to consider, and decision-making.
Track the number of leads getting in each stage and compare these figures to those that progress further.
Make use of tools such as Google Analytics to get comprehensive insights.

Roi
Roi (ROI) is a crucial metric for examining the monetary success of a marketing funnel, as it shows the efficiency of marketing expenses in creating earnings. By analyzing ROI, services can figure out which marketing channels and methods supply the greatest returns, therefore optimizing resource allotment and informing future marketing decisions.
To accurately determine ROI, companies typically use the formula: ROI = (Net Profit/ Expense of Investment) x 100%. This formula allows online marketers to measure the worth produced from their projects relative to the costs incurred.
For instance, if a company introduces a social media campaign with an expense of $10,000 that results in $50,000 in sales, the ROI would be 400%. The use of sophisticated analytics tools, such as Google Analytics or HubSpot, substantially boosts ROI analysis, allowing companies to keep an eye on engagement levels, conversion rates, and client acquisition costs.
For example, a merchant may track e-mail campaigns to determine the most reliable messaging and target demographics.
This information equips online marketers to make educated adjustments, facilitating constant enhancement of their techniques gradually.
By leveraging these insights, organizations can fine-tune their marketing initiatives and ensure that their investments yield ideal success.
